Research Scientist - Complex Systems & Network Modeling (5673)

Position Responsibilities

Support ERDC's technical evaluation of project development for supply chain visibility and stress-testing tools on an agile development cycle across multiple customers.
Conduct foundational and applied research on the behavior of complex systems under stress through network models.
Collaborate closely with backend engineering teams within an agile development framework, providing continuous evaluation and subject matter expertise.
Analyze and model cascading failures across interdependent critical infrastructure networks (e.g., power, water, communications).
Translate abstract government challenges into tractable, well-defined research problems.
Present generalized research findings for broad audiences in civil and military work.

Position Requirements

  • Must possess a PhD in one of the following fields: Engineering, Network Science, Neuroscience, Computer Science, Statistics, or similar fields. Experienced researcher with MS will also be considered.
  • Demonstrable research experience in understanding and modeling the impact of external stimuli on complex networks.
  • A strong and consistent record of publications in top-tier, peer-reviewed academic journals is highly preferred.
  • Proven, high-level skill in communicating complex scientific concepts, research, and results to both expert and non-expert audiences.
  • Strong proficiency in a programming language (e.g. Python, SQL, Julia) is required.
  • Experience with graph database technologies (e.g., Neo4j, TigerGraph, Amazon Neptune) or big data processing frameworks (e.g. Apache Spark, Scala etc.) preferred.
  • Demonstrated ability to successfully manage multiple, often disparate, research projects concurrently across different domains.
  • Prior experience working in a fast-paced, client-focused consulting or advisory environment is a significant plus.

Security Requirements

  • Security Clearance Level: Secret
  • Must be a US Citizen with the ability to obtain a US Government security clearance.
  • Successful Pass of Bennett Aerospace Background Investigation, Drug Screening and Credit Check.
